Having expunged most of the remaining organic material in his body the Archmagos known as Draykavac has a fearsome reputation, thinking nothing of sacrificing thousands of lives to further his knowledge and understanding. When the Heresy broke out, Draykavac and his followers joined the Warmaster in his war against the Imperium, allowing him greater freedom to research forbidden technologies.

This model also comes with an alternate head that can be used to represent a Magos Prime and an Abeyant to lead any Mechanicum force. The model includes weapon options for the Abeyant: graviton gun, conversion beamer, rotor cannon and irad cleanser.

Designed by Mark Bedford and Rob Macfarlane, Archmagos Draykavac / Magos Prime is available to pre-order now and will be despatched from Friday 26th September.
